There’s a valuable footwork concept that is not being taught enough in the tennis world. In this lesson, Jeff Salzenstein reveals a powerful secret tip that will transform your forehand footwork. He will demonstrate it step by step, so you can develop the right rhythm, tempo, and balance on your tennis movement. And you can practice this tip at home without even hitting the ball. Jeff has seen that when tennis players move, they don’t split step on time and don’t r make the correct first move with their feet. You’ve got to work on your first move, one of the cornerstones of the Tennis Evolution system. Therefore, Jeff goes over the ready position fundamentals during this tennis lesson. These are a couple of tips to keep in mind. Keep your arms relaxed, and the racquet tip slightly angled by holding a forehand grip. Get your feet in a wide base, outside your shoulders. As soon as you see that the ball is coming to your forehand, make a solid first move by keeping your elbow away from the body, and the off arm straight. Afterwards, your goal is to coordinate the upper body movement with your first step. It could be a drop step, shuffle, step in or step out depending on the ball. You’ve got to take care of these fundamentals in order to be able to move effortlessly on the court, and start crushing your groundstrokes consistently. Jeff was a top 100 ATP professional in singles and doubles and was the oldest American to ever break the top 100 in the world after the age of 30. During his 11 year pro career filled with injuries and setbacks, Jeff was determined to discover simple methods to make tennis learning easy and fun for himself and for all players committed to improving. Jeff is passionate about peak performance in the areas of nutrition, fitness, injury prevention, and mindset, and much more.
